The Phoenix Contact Network Cable is engineered for high-performance Ethernet connectivity, specifically designed to meet the demands of industrial applications. Featuring a robust PUR halogen-free outer sheath with a striking water blue finish, this cable ensures durability and reliability under rigorous conditions. Its shielded design incorporates Advanced Shielding Technology to minimise interference, making it ideal for environments with high electromagnetic noise. The angled M12 Push Pull connectors facilitate quick and secure connections, while the cable's compact length of 0.3 m optimally suits space-constrained setups.

Suitable for a wide range of applications including automation and smart infrastructure

Includes colour coded wires for straightforward installation

Offers excellent thermal resistance for high ambient temperature operations

Manufactured from quality materials to withstand mechanical stress
